Hydrophobicity parameters determined by reversed-phase liquid chromatography. IV. Shortcoming of log KW approach for prediction of log P of pyrazines was written by Yamagami, Chisako;Takao, Narao. And the article was included in Chemistry Express in 1991.Related Products of 6924-68-1 This article mentions the following:
The capacity factors of monosubstituted pyrazines on a C18-modified column were measured. The observed and extrapolated log kW (capacity factor in 100% water) values were compared with log P. The results suggested that the conventional log kW approach would not be applicable in the prediction of the log P value of polar solutes. Ethyl pyrazine-2-carboxylate (cas: 6924-68-1) belongs to pyrazine derivatives. Pyrazines are part of several biologically active polycyclic compounds; examples are quinoxalines, phenazines; and the bio-luminescent natural products pteridines, flavins, and their derivatives. Pyrazine-based skeletons were incorporated into agents targeting a range of ailments. Many derivatives were synthesized and evaluated as potential cancer treatments.Related Products of 6924-68-1
